During National CPR and AED Awareness Week, the American Red Cross aims to train as many people as possible in Hands-Only CPR. Studies show that when a person is experiencing cardiac arrest and CPR is performed, even using hands only, their chances of survival increase dramatically. Hands-only CPR is a free and quick training that equips participants with the confidence and skills to act during an emergency until help arrives.
